About the Opportunity

Clinton is a small community that serves as the primary entry point to the varied and unique rural communities that reside on Whidbey Island. The library is a vital resource to connect these communities with basic library services, safe spaces to access knowledge and resources, and equitable programming for youth, families, and adults.
 
A full-time Library Associate at the Clinton Library will work closely with a small team to provide skilled paraprofessional library support services, including general reference, circulation services, and basic technology troubleshooting. The successful candidate will help to lead a programming effort that will provide services and programs to adults and older adults and will collaborate with other Library Associates at nearby branches and within the team at Clinton to provide services and programs that are representative of diverse cultures and perspectives, intentionally inclusive, and accessible to everyone.
 
Due to programming needs and community engagement, work schedules may necessitate morning, afternoon, evening, and weekend hours in addition to availability during the five days a week the Clinton Library is open (Tuesday-Saturday). The successful candidate may be required to adapt to future schedule and location changes depending on library needs. Essential Functions

Functions listed are intended only as illustrations of the various types of work performed. The omission of specific duties does not exclude them from the position if the work is similar, related or a logical assignment to the position. Reasonable accommodation may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ions of this job.

1.    Provide general, basic reference and information service by assisting customers in the use of library facilities, equipment, resources, and services. Refer complex readers' advisory and reference questions to a Librarian or appropriate staff member.

2.    Provide courteous and efficient customer service by performing circulation desk tasks.

3.    Create and present programming for all customer groups as assigned.

4.    Develop program materials, including reading lists, promotional displays, and presentation materials.

5.    Provide training to customers in basic library skills including the use of public computers, catalog and reference computers, Internet, and devices.

6.    Assist customers in resolving technical problems or issues. Maintain and troubleshoot equipment utilized in a community library.

7.    Perform collection maintenance activities through the use of reports and data, to include weeding the collection for condition as well as reallocation of library materials.

8.    Perform other library support services including opening and closing buildings and assisting in maintaining the library in neat, clean, and orderly condition.

9.    May be designated in charge of the community library in the absence of other supervisory staff or building manager.

10.  Travel from one work site to another as staffing needs require.

The Community

Sno-Isle Libraries is a large, two-county library district in the beautiful north Puget Sound region of Washington State. District boundaries stretch from rugged timberlands to suburban centers, from rolling farmlands to the ocean vistas. Set in the fastest-growing corner of the state, Sno-Isle Libraries serves more than 800,000 residents through 23 community libraries, online services, Library on Wheels, and our website at www.sno-isle.org.
